Skoda has revealed the new Skoda Superb at an event in Prague this evening.

Having found more than 700,000 buyers, the Superb enters the third generation, and is shaped by the VisionC concept. The wheelbase has grown by 80 mm, while the front overhang is shortened by 61 mm, giving it a more dynamic appearance.

Up front, the car is defined by the distinctive grille, and sharply cut headlights. The side profile is characterized by narrow pillars, a chiseled waistline and a gently sloping roof, giving the appearance of a luxury coupe, says Skoda.

Moving to the rear, the car features taillamps with LED elements, with the C-shaped detailing.

Compared to the previous generation, interior space in the new model Superb is even better with 157 mm rear leg room and 69 mm better elbow room compared to the previous model. It offers a luggage compartment with a volume of 625 liters, which is 30 liters more than the second generation.

Coming to the features the car adopts the Dynamic Chassis Control (DCC) with Driving Mode Select, a new three-zone automatic climate control, electrically operated panoramic tilt and slide roof, heated seats, windshield and washer nozzles, rain sensor and light sensor.

The car also comes with a new electrically operated tailgate, Park Assist for automated parking, and rear view camera.

The third generation model gets four new infotainment system options. The top-end version comes with integrated high speed internet access based on LTE. The SmartLink interface includes MirrorLink ™, Apple CarPlay and Android Auto. The SmartGate interface, developed by Skoda, allows you to send the selected vehicle data into an application on the driver's smartphone.

The audio system uses twelve speakers and has a 610 watt power output.

Talking about the mechanical kit, the new Superb consumes up to 30 percent lesser fuel than the outgoing car, thanks to the 75 kg weight loss and improved aerodynamics.

The 2016 Superb comes with five petrol engines and three diesel engine options - 1.4 TSI (125 PS/200 Nm), 1.4 TSI (150 PS/250 Nm), 1.8 TSI (180 PS/250 Nm), 2.0 TSI (220 PS/350 Nm) and 2.0 TSI (280 PS/350 Nm) for petrol and 1.6 TDI (120 PS/250 Nm), 2.0 TDI (150 PS/340 Nm) and 2.0 TDI (190 PS/400 Nm) for diesel.

All engines meet the emission standards of EU6 and are fitted with a start-stop system and brake energy recuperation.

With the exception of the basic petrol engine, all others are paired to a modern dual-clutch DSG gearbox. Also on offer is an all-wheel drive variant featuring the 5th generation Haldex system.

In the safety department, the new Superb is equipped as standard with electronic stability control (ESC), emergency brake function, electronic tire pressure monitor, seven airbags, five three-point seatbelts and optional rear side airbags.

Optionally, the new Superb can be further equipped with Adaptive Cruise Control (ACC), Lane Assist system helps and Traffic Jam Assist system.
